Hispanic Chamber of Commerce v. Arizonans for Fair Representation

507 U.S. 981, 113 S. Ct. 1573
CourtSupreme Court of the United States
DecidedMarch 22, 1993
DocketNo. 92-362

Hispanic Chamber of Commerce v. Arizonans for Fair Representation, 507 U.S. 981, 113 S. Ct. 1573 (1993).

Opinion

Affirmed on appeal from D. C. Ariz.

Justice O’Connor took no part in the consideration or decision of this case.
